Newcastle University is offering a small number of research scholarships for UK/EU students and international students. Scholarships are awarded for outstanding international students to commence PhD studies in any subject during the 2014/15 academic year. Applicants must have already applied for and been offered a place to study at Newcastle University before apply for a NUORS award. Each award (value approximately £5,000 to £9,000 per annum) covers the difference between fees for UK/EU students and international students.
25th April 2014 is application deadline.
Margaret McNamara Memorial Fund is offering award for women applicants of developing countries to pursue their degree in the USA and Canada. Applicants must enrolled (in residence) at an accredited U.S. or Canadian educational institution for the academic year 2013-14 and intends to be enrolled for the 2014-15 academic year. An MMMF grant covers only a portion of the total costs for an academic year. Therefore, applicants need to access other financial resources.
Application deadline is January 15, 2014.
University of St. Andrews offers International Honours Scholarships for Excellence in the fields of Economics, English, History or International Relations in the UK. The students of Scotland, England, Northern Ireland, Wales, EU can apply for these scholarships. International students can also apply. The Selection Committee seeks applicants who are gifted students with academic excellence. Successful scholars will be expected to fulfill an ambassadorial role and represent the University at a number of events and contribute to various University publications.
The application deadline is 31st March 2014.
Applications are invited for IST fellowship programme to qualified applicants from all over the world who are interested in spending the postdoctoral stage of their scientific research career at IST Austria. All applicants must have completed doctoral studies or the equivalent or anticipate the completion of their studies prior to the commencement of the position. This will fund 40 fellows for a period of two years each. All ISTFELLOW recipients will be offered full-time employment contracts at IST Austria and will receive an internationally competitive salary with full social security coverage.
Application deadline is 15 March 2014.
Nottingham Trent University is offering international scholarships in the fields of Journalism, Media and Globalization, English Language Teaching and International Development. The scholarships are available for pursuing postgraduate degree level. Applicants must be holding an NTU offer when they apply. Applicants should not submit their scholarship application before or with the application to study at NTU. Students may apply for as many scholarships as they want but they may only be awarded one scholarship. The scholarships will cover half-fee for October 2014.
25th July 2014 is the application deadline.
